The 5-Step Screening Protocol

Modern battery screening combines cutting-edge technology with tried-and-tested methods:

1. Initial Cell Sorting

Using automated optical inspection (AOI) systems, we categorize cells by:

  • Voltage consistency (±0.5%)
  • Internal resistance variation (<3%)
  • Capacity matching (within 1.5%)

2. Thermal Runaway Simulation

Our climate chambers replicate extreme conditions:

TestParametersPass Rate
High Temp60°C for 48h98.2%
Low Temp-30°C cycling96.7%
